Ya but the 75 is probably even more narrow than the 80 in the engine bay. I have measured it before and could dig up FSM frame specs but if I recall right it is at least 1/2” narrower than the 80.

Something else to note is the steering box is completely different as far as location on the frame and which direction it throws on an 80 vs a 70. I would personally really like to use the 79 box that came with the body. It’s brand new and rather stout looking.

Cheers
 
75/73 is 1" narrower frame at engine
